Inter-League Local Rule Exceptions
To 2005 ASA Rules
To be posted clearly by each league at all venues
Rules voted and confirmed by the following participating  Leagues:
Dewey Recreation Association (John Green-Baseball, Warren Thomas  -Softball), Nowata Baseball/Softball (Robert Webb-Baseball, Tracy  Hicks-Softball), Barnsdall Softball (Pam Moore), Oklahoma Union  Baseball/Softball (George Hiatt), Caney Valley Softball (Jerry  Street).
Any issue associated with these rules should be directed to your league  representative.
Any rule not listed here shall keep its rule definition as described and  written in the rules published by the National Governing Body (USSSA or ASA as  applicable).
ASA Rule Exceptions - General
Facemask required on all batting helmets 10U level and up.
All batting helmets will be properly equipped with fastened chinstraps.
If while running the bases the runner's helmet comes off, the runner will be out.
ASA umpires behind the plate for U10 & up.
Minimum age for umpires in Coach Pitch & T-ball 16.
Run rules 6 runs/inning 15 in 3, 12 in 4, or 10 in 5.
Baselines are 60'.
Pitching circle is 8' diameter.
Official Ball for Regular Season Play: 12" Ball
ASA Rule Exceptions - U12 and U14
Bat fielders only.
Pitching Rubber is 40' from back of home plate.
No inning shall start after (
12U - 1hr 20 min. - 14U - 1hr      30min)
Runner must slide if play is close.
